We seem to be enabling wrong evsels. > > I'll continue to look at this, but any help would be appreciated. > > Thanks, > John Hi John, The fix to avoid uncore_ events being deduplicated against each other added complexity to the code and means that metric-no-group doesn't really work any more. I have it on my list of things to look at. It relates to what you are looking at as the deduplication afterward is tricky given the funny invariants on evsel names. I think it would be easier to deduplicate events before doing the event parse. It may also be good to change evsels so that they own the string for their name (this would mean uncore_imc events could have unique names and not get deduplicated against each other). The invariants around cycles in your change look weird, but I can see how it might workaround an issue. My attempts to reproduce the issue weren't successful on a SkylakeX.
